Mosaicists in front of the “trial of three” in Venice in the second half of the 16th century

Posted on December 19, 2022December 21, 2022

The artist is Bronnikov

In 1539, a tribunal of three inquisitors was established in Venice to combat political turmoil – the “court of three”. One inquisitor was elected from the members of the Council of Doge who wore red clothing, and two others who were dressed in black clothes were appointed from the so -called council of the ten – the guardian who monitored the internal order in the republic.
